Effective conflict management is essential for building strong and cohesive teams. When conflicts are handled properly, they can lead to improved understanding, innovation, and team cohesion. This article explores key techniques to manage conflicts and enhance team dynamics.
Understanding Conflict in Teams
Conflict is a natural part of any team environment. It often arises from differences in opinions, goals, or values. Recognizing the types of conflict—such as task conflict, relationship conflict, or process conflict—can help in choosing the appropriate management strategies.
Effective Conflict Management Techniques
1. Active Listening
Active listening involves fully concentrating on what others are saying, understanding their message, and responding thoughtfully. This technique fosters mutual respect and reduces misunderstandings.
2. Open Communication
Encouraging open and honest communication allows team members to express their concerns without fear of judgment. Establishing a safe environment promotes transparency and trust.
3. Mediation and Facilitation
Using a neutral third party to mediate conflicts can help facilitate understanding and guide the team toward mutually acceptable solutions. Skilled mediators can de-escalate tensions effectively.
Benefits of Conflict Resolution
Proper conflict management leads to numerous benefits, including:
- Enhanced team cohesion
- Improved problem-solving skills
- Increased innovation and creativity
- Higher job satisfaction
By applying these conflict management techniques, teams can transform disagreements into opportunities for growth and development, ultimately strengthening team dynamics and achieving shared goals.
